In Arizona, an SR-22 is a document your insurance company sends to the state’s MVD to verify you have purchased insurance coverage that meets its minimum requirements. Mandatory Insurance. Arizona requires that every motor vehicle operated on roads in the state be covered by liability insurance through a company that is authorized to do business in Arizona. Luckily, motorcy...In Arizona, the minimum liability-only coverage requirement for all motor vehicles is 25/50/15. This means your motorcycle insurance in Arizona should have liability limits of at least $25,000 for bodily injury per person, with a total of $50,000 per accident and $15,000 for property damage liability coverage. ATV insurance can help protect your off-road vehicle from collisions, theft and much more.Arizona Moped Registration & Insurance. Titles are not issued to mopeds in AZ. However, you will need to register the moped each year. In most jurisdictions, the fee is about $4.50 – $5 per year. You’ll need to carry a valid insurance policy.
